Salamis is a non-agricultural and nonindustrial vacuum world, which warrants hazardous environment precautions.

  • Life in a vacuum requires great discipline. After all, it only takes one forgotten seal on a vacuum suit to spell death. Those who survive tend to be very methodically-minded and attentive to small detail.
  • It requires extensive imports of outside technology to maintain a modern, star-faring society.
  • It is unable to produce quality foodstuffs and must import them.
  • It has few prospects for economic development.
  • This is a "high technology" world with technology achievements at, near, or over technology standards for Charted Space.
  • This world is a "Twilight Zone World", a planet that is tidally-locked to its star. It has a hot side that permanently faces the star, a cold side that permanently faces away, and a narrow twilight zone in-between.
  • This is a hot world, with a climate of high temperatures.
  • It is a member of the Solomani Confederation in the Wovoka Subsector of Aldebaran Sector.

Mainworld Data[edit]

Salamis is a small, dry, vacuum world tidally locked to its K-class primary.

Mainworld Geography & Topography[edit]

Salamis is denser than average, as it contains an unusually high amount of uranium, thorium, and classically precious metals. Though Salamis is small, it has a hot, spinning center that generates a strong magnetic field. This core is highly unique in that it spins within a planet that is, on the surface, tidally-locked. As a result, there is active scientific debate on the possibility of terraforming Salamis and creating an atmosphere over the next 50 years.

There is active tectonics in every corner of Salamis, producing groundquakes and active volcanos.

World Government[edit]

Salamis has a Captive Government or Colony. The world is ruled by an external government, there is no self-rule. A colony or conquered area. The local government is an oligarchy appointed by, and answerable only to, the external government.

The Salamis Central Committee is appointed by the Europan Dictat personally. The committee is backed up by a substantial Europan military presence, both in-system and planet-side.

World Military[edit]

The equivalent of 2 Army divisions are deployed here, planet-side, under Europan Starforce command.

2 to 4 Europan heavy cruisers armed as missle boats are here at any given time. Solomani Navy capital ships are welcomed for occasional port visits.

The Europan transplanted culture is strongly military-influenced, and the Anglic is punctuated with obscure combat acronyms.
